As the world’s largest student technology competition, the Imagine Cup provides an opportunity for brilliant young minds to use technology to solve some of the world’s toughest problems. Each year the competition features several categories and a unique altruistic theme. The United Nations has identified key challenges in its Millennium Goals and Imagine Cup is aligning to these goals as the guiding light to inspire positive change all over the world. This year’s theme is “Imagine a world where technology helps solve the toughest problems facing us today.”

The Software Design Semi Finals are held locally in more than 60 countries, including the Philippines. Contestants compete in the locals and, as with the Olympics, all finalists of each countries compete at the world finals, which are held in a different country each year. For this year, the host city for the finals is Warsaw, Poland.

Project L.I.G.T.A.S (Location-based Information Gathering for Tragedy Alleviation System) is a web-based disaster control and coordination system which provides a wide range of features and functionalities that are mission-critical for better relief and service operations, and heightened prevention and remedy mechanisms for the Filipino community in disaster-related incidents.
